Tagg For iPhone Uses Facial Recognition To Tag And Share Photos On Facebook & Twitter
Tagg is a newly launched iPhone application that uses offline facial recognition to detect the faces of your friends in your photos, so you can tag them and upload them to Facebook or post them to Twitter. The app takes advantage of new frameworks in iOS5, like CoreImage, for example, which among other things also enables dead simple face detection.
